When the atria contract, which of the following is true? a. The AV valves are closed. b. The ventricles are in diastole. c. The

atria are in diastole. d. The semilunar valves are open.

Answer:

b. The ventricles are in diastole.

Explanation:

Atrial systole is the phase of the cardiac cycle that lasts for about 0.1 sec. During this phase, the atria are contracting. At the same time, the ventricles are relaxed or are in diastole. The pressure of the contraction of atria forces the blood to open the AV valves. The blood enters the ventricles through the open AV valves. During this phase, the semilunar valves are closed as the blood pressure in ventricles is very low. The P wave of ECG represents the atrial systole. This is followed by the systole of ventricles.
